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Algiers to Barcelona is to fly which costs €30 - €230 and takes 4h 53m.
The fastest way to get from Algiers to Barcelona is to fly which takes 4h 53m and costs €30 - €230.
The distance between Algiers and Barcelona is 563 km.
The best way to get from Algiers to Barcelona without a car is to car ferry and train which takes 27h 58m and costs €320 - €380.
It takes approximately 4h 53m to get from Algiers to Barcelona, including transfers.
Barcelona is 1h ahead of Algiers. It is currently 10:45 AM in Algiers and 11:45 AM in Barcelona.

What companies run services between Algiers, Algeria and Barcelona, Spain?
Vueling Airlines and Air Algérie fly from Houari Boumediene Airport (ALG) to Barcelona–El Prat Airport (BCN) 3 times a day.
